Stump Grinding retainer walls

It was a bit of a challenge to get our stump grinding machine into position because of the landscaping block retainer wall around the perimeter of the front yard. I used some large timber blocks that I keep in my truck for such occasions. First, I use the blocks to step up the small end of the grinder and simply drive it up into the yard.

The tricky part is getting the heavy end of the machine with the dual wheels and cutter wheel into the yard. I accomplish this by driving ahead until the wheels are up against the retainer wall. Then I position the boom to the side and lower it into the ground, to jack up that side of the stump grinder. Now I simply slide a couple of timbers under the raised wheels. When I raise the boom, the machine settles on the timbers which are stacked to a height equal to the retainer wall. I repeat the process so both sides are now on timbers stacked to a height equal to the retaining wall. At that point, I can simply drive ahead into the yard.

We set up our plywood to contain any flying debris. Once underway, I focus on eliminating the surface roots first. Lastly, I grind out the stump. Our target stump grinding depth on this project was 18 inches below the grade.
